Transaction 7aaeefbbc70931d69bef5f12ec335beedf30ab85885940962939ab1f4eb9ca36
1 Input
2 Outputs
- 7aaeefbbc70931d69bef5f12ec335beedf30ab85885940962939ab1f4eb9ca36:0
- 7aaeefbbc70931d69bef5f12ec335beedf30ab85885940962939ab1f4eb9ca36:1
value 90577
address 1B1NahWqzjTBhbAF5JWBFdbberQikwMoCm
value 1043767044
address 14wtdhkT1mgrzw3WF77mUVQqAofrASyLsK